3KASMC43AHE3/57T Product Overview

Introduction

The 3KASMC43AHE3/57T is a semiconductor product belonging to the category of TVS (Transient Voltage Suppressor) diodes. This entry provides an in-depth overview of the product, including its basic information, specifications, pin configuration, functional features, advantages and disadvantages, working principles, application field plans, and alternative models.

Basic Information Overview

  • Category: TVS Diodes
  • Use: Protection against transient voltage spikes
  • Characteristics: High surge capability, low clamping voltage, fast response time
  • Package: SMC (Surface Mount Compatible)
  • Essence: Safeguarding electronic circuits from voltage surges
  • Packaging/Quantity: Available in reels or bulk packaging, quantity varies based on supplier

Specifications

  • Part Number: 3KASMC43AHE3/57T
  • Voltage Rating: 43V
  • Power Dissipation: 3000W
  • Breakdown Voltage: 47.8V
  • Operating Temperature Range: -55°C to 150°C
  • Mounting Type: Surface Mount
  • Package / Case: DO-214AB (SMC)

Working Principles

When a transient voltage spike occurs, the TVS diode conducts current to divert the excess energy away from sensitive components. By providing a low impedance path, it limits the voltage across the protected circuit.
